Thomas Gould

Question:

61. Deputy Thomas Gould asked the Minister for Housing, Local Government and Heritage the number of projects under construction or planning for Cork under the Land Development Agency; and the locations of same. [28331/20]

View answer

Written answers

The Land Development Agency (LDA) was established on an interim basis in September 2018, by way of an Establishment Order made under the Local Government Services (Corporate Bodies) Act 1971, pending the enactment of primary legislation when it will be established as a commercial State agency.

On establishment, the Agency had access to an initial tranche of 9 sites including St. Kevin's Hospital in Cork. Based on information provided by the LDA to my Department, I can confirm that the LDA is currently progressing the 14 acre site at St. Kevin’s which will provide approximately 270 homes. It is now at preplanning stage with An Bórd Pleanála and it is envisaged that a planning application will be lodged before the end of 2020.
